I sent my girl's hip and elbow x-rays to the WDA to be sent to the SV in the middle of November...maybe a little earlier.  I was just curious to see if anyone has sent theirs in recently and how long they took to come back.

I am not in any hurry since her OFA results came back fine, I am just worried that they might get lost in the mail or something :( Since I do have problems occasionally with receiving mail sometimes - especially important things it seems!


Would the results be posted on the SV database when they are complete?  I know it's only updated quarterly, but I'm not sure if they'll add new entries as they get them.

If you are going thru the USA you can check with Pam in their office, usually takes 10 weeks, but she can tell you the status of them. I know someone that's been waiting almost 4 months, she was told that SV has only 1 vet for hips, he's like 80 years old and retired to Argentina, need to wait till he's in town to get them done. Person I know's dog is in Germany and she told me the Germans checked with the SV and that is what they told them.


by Kovey on 05 February 2009 - 13:02

Mine typically average 3-4 months.  The one I sent in August is still not back which is not normal.  When I emailed the SV they told me back in Nov. the elbows were done but they were waiting on the hips.  Just last week I emailed again and the hips were finally done.  I would guess I will get everything back in the next month.  It does appear that currently there is a bit of a bottleneck with hips.  I spoke to Pam at the USA and she was hearing similar stuff....elbows done but waiting on hips.
